Hello Lucian,

can you please provide the output of "q devcl ULTRIUM5W f=d"?
Did you define using Worm-Tape Format and no Worm-Tapes are available as 
Scratch?

Regards, Uwe

But when I try to archive something I get this error

"ANR1639I Attributes changed for node HRARCH1P: TCP Name from vme-file01 to 
vme-file02, TCP Address from 192.168.81.63 to 192.168.81.57, GUID from 
86.73.fd.ce.e1.ae.11.e3.9a.b9.ac.16.2d.b4.c2.58 to 
87.48.e7.28.2c.40.11.e4.b3.c3.6c.3b.e5.b9.54.48.
ANR1405W Scratch volume mount request denied - no scratch volume available.
ANR1405W Scratch volume mount request denied - no scratch volume available.
ANR1405W Scratch volume mount request denied - no scratch volume available.
ANR0522W Transaction failed for session 4053 for node HRARCH1P (Linux
x86-64) - no space available in storage pool STDHRDISKW and all successor pools.
ANR0480W Session 4053 for node HRARCH1P (Linux x86-64) terminated - connection 
with client severed.
"


I have no idea how I can debug / fix this
